我正在运行SQL命令,当出现错误时我想停用我的插件。我是用wp_die
做的还是其他一些首选方法?
答案 0 :(得分:0)
我的理解是插件激活/取消激活由数据库中的wp_options表控制。
您可能会考虑停用特定插件的第二个MySQL调用。您可以使用以下方法获取所有活动插件:
SELECT * FROM wp_options WHERE option_name = 'active_plugins';
您可以使用以下内容更新列表:
UPDATE wp_options SET option_value = 'a:0:{}' WHERE option_name = 'active_plugins';
显然,你想修改它以定位特定的插件。
我看到这个方法使用here,其中作者描述了如何通过MySQL查询停用所有插件。希望这会有所帮助。